## Introduction
|
||
|
||
Laravel's "context" capabilities enable you to capture, retrieve, and share
|
||
information throughout requests, jobs, and commands executing within your
|
||
application. This captured information is also included in logs written by
|
||
your application, giving you deeper insight into the surrounding code
|
||
execution history that occurred before a log entry was written and allowing
|
||
you to trace execution flows throughout a distributed system.

## Hidden Context
|
||
|
||
Context offers the ability to store "hidden" data. This hidden information is
|
||
not appended to logs, and is not accessible via the data retrieval methods
|
||
documented above. Context provides a different set of methods to interact with
|
||
hidden context information:
|
||
|
||
|
||
|
||
1use Illuminate\Support\Facades\Context;
|
||
|
||
2
|
||
|
||
3Context::addHidden('key', 'value');
|
||
|
||
4
|
||
|
||
5Context::getHidden('key');
|
||
|
||
6// 'value'
|
||
|
||
7
|
||
|
||
8Context::get('key');
|
||
|
||
9// null
|
||
|
||
|
||
use Illuminate\Support\Facades\Context;
|
||
|
||
Context::addHidden('key', 'value');
|
||
|
||
Context::getHidden('key');
|
||
// 'value'
|
||
|
||
Context::get('key');
|
||
// null
|
||
|
||
The "hidden" methods mirror the functionality of the non-hidden methods
|
||
documented above:

## Events
|
||
|
||
Context dispatches two events that allow you to hook into the hydration and
|
||
dehydration process of the context.
|
||
|
||
To illustrate how these events may be used, imagine that in a middleware of
|
||
your application you set the `app.locale` configuration value based on the
|
||
incoming HTTP request's `Accept-Language` header. Context's events allow you
|
||
to capture this value during the request and restore it on the queue, ensuring
|
||
notifications sent on the queue have the correct `app.locale` value. We can
|
||
use context's events and hidden data to achieve this, which the following
|
||
documentation will illustrate.
|
||
|
||
### Dehydrating
|
||
|
||
Whenever a job is dispatched to the queue the data in the context is
|
||
"dehydrated" and captured alongside the job's payload. The
|
||
`Context::dehydrating` method allows you to register a closure that will be
|
||
invoked during the dehydration process. Within this closure, you may make
|
||
changes to the data that will be shared with the queued job.
|
||
|
||
Typically, you should register `dehydrating` callbacks within the `boot`
|
||
method of your application's `AppServiceProvider` class:
|
||
|
||
|
||
|
||
1use Illuminate\Log\Context\Repository;
|
||
|
||
2use Illuminate\Support\Facades\Config;
|
||
|
||
3use Illuminate\Support\Facades\Context;
|
||
|
||
4
|
||
|
||
5/**
|
||
|
||
6 * Bootstrap any application services.
|
||
|
||
7 */
|
||
|
||
8public function boot(): void
|
||
|
||
9{
|
||
|
||
10 Context::dehydrating(function (Repository $context) {
|
||
|
||
11 $context->addHidden('locale', Config::get('app.locale'));
|
||
|
||
12 });
|
||
|
||
13}
|
||
|
||
|
||
use Illuminate\Log\Context\Repository;
|
||
use Illuminate\Support\Facades\Config;
|
||
use Illuminate\Support\Facades\Context;
|
||
|
||
/**
|
||
* Bootstrap any application services.
|
||
*/
|
||
public function boot(): void
|
||
{
|
||
Context::dehydrating(function (Repository $context) {
|
||
$context->addHidden('locale', Config::get('app.locale'));
|
||
});
|
||
}
|
||
|
||
You should not use the `Context` facade within the `dehydrating` callback, as
|
||
that will change the context of the current process. Ensure you only make
|
||
changes to the repository passed to the callback.
|
||
|
||
### Hydrated
|
||
|
||
Whenever a queued job begins executing on the queue, any context that was
|
||
shared with the job will be "hydrated" back into the current context. The
|
||
`Context::hydrated` method allows you to register a closure that will be
|
||
invoked during the hydration process.
